Android屏幕投影工具scrcpy使用教程与特性解析
需积分: 50 99 浏览量
更新于2024-11-04
收藏 15.7MB RAR 举报
资源摘要信息:"Android USB 投屏工具"
Android USB 投屏工具是一种能够将Android设备的屏幕实时投射到PC端的软件。开发者可以通过此工具在PC上直接查看和操作Android设备的屏幕,这对于进行Android开发时遇到的屏幕调试问题,提供了极大的便利。接下来,我们将详细解析该工具的相关知识点。
一、Android USB 投屏工具的工作原理
该工具依赖于Android Debug Bridge (ADB) 来实现设备与PC之间的通信。ADB 是一个多功能命令行工具,允许用户与Android设备进行通信,它能控制Android设备的命令行接口,用于安装和调试应用程序。
二、ADB 的作用和功能
ADB 包括以下主要功能:
1. 在设备与开发机器之间复制文件。
2. 在设备上运行shell命令。
3. 将应用程序安装到设备上。
4. 进行设备的屏幕截图和录制。
5. 运行调试会话。
6. 提供与设备之间的USB连接。
当启用ADB调试模式时,Android设备会通过USB连接到PC,并识别为一个可操作的端点,从而实现Android设备屏幕的实时投射。
三、Android USB 投屏工具的具体使用场景
在以下场景中,Android USB 投屏工具能够发挥其作用:
1. 屏幕尺寸不合适:当开发者的设备屏幕尺寸太小,或者分辨率过低导致无法清楚查看界面时,可以使用投屏工具在PC的大屏幕上进行调试。
2. 远程调试:如果开发者不在设备旁边,比如在另一间房间或另一座城市,可以远程连接设备进行调试。
3. 调试大屏幕应用:对于开发大屏幕或折叠屏应用的开发者来说,他们可以在PC上模拟大屏幕进行应用的调试和测试。
4. 多设备并行调试:当需要同时调试多个设备时,PC端可以一次连接多个设备,并进行分别的屏幕投射和操作,提高工作效率。
四、如何使用Android USB 投屏工具
要使用Android USB 投屏工具,开发者需要:
1. 确保设备上已经启用了开发者选项和USB调试。
2. 将Android设备通过USB线连接到PC。
3. 在PC上安装ADB工具,并启动ADB服务。
4. 在PC上安装投屏工具,如本次提到的scrcpy-win64-v1.10版本。
5. 运行投屏工具,开始投屏操作。
五、关于scrcpy-win64-v1.10文件
scrcpy-win64-v1.10是一个特定版本的屏幕镜像工具,专为64位Windows操作系统设计。该软件的版本号“1.10”表示这是该工具的第10次重要更新版本。该版本的软件文件通常会包含以下内容:
1. 主执行文件:用于执行投屏操作。
2. 配置文件:可能包括一些配置选项,如分辨率设置、帧率设置等。
3. 相关库文件:支持软件运行所需的其他代码库或依赖项。
4. 说明文档:通常包含如何安装和使用该软件的说明。
六、Android USB 投屏工具的优缺点
优点:
1. 方便性:不需要将屏幕直接显示在物理设备上,可远程操作,极大提高调试效率。
2. 性能:相比使用模拟器,投屏工具能更真实地反映出应用在物理设备上的表现。
3. 易于配置:对于已经熟悉ADB工具的开发者来说,配置和使用该投屏工具相对简单。
缺点:
1. 网络要求:需要PC与Android设备之间有稳定且快速的网络连接。
2. 兼容性问题:不是所有的Android设备都能完美支持该工具,可能存在某些设备兼容性问题。
3. 功能局限:该工具主要用于屏幕投射和简单的操作,没有提供模拟器那样完整的设备模拟环境。
总结来说,Android USB 投屏工具是Android开发者在进行屏幕调试和测试过程中一个非常实用的辅助工具,能够显著提高开发效率和改善调试体验。
2023-05-31 上传
2024-09-26 上传
2020-10-19 上传
2021-06-08 上传
2022-05-11 上传
2019-09-05 上传
Lvvv666
- 粉丝: 10
- 资源: 12
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能